Description

We are ringing in the New Year with our first-ever daily episode series! Every single day of January, we are posting a mini-episode geared towards helping people with the most common New Year's resolution: to exercise more. This series is meant to be hyper-practical, tackling things like finding a routine, overcoming gym anxiety, creating consistency and so much more! (Including a deep dive into Eddie's gym fashion.)

In this episode, we discuss the best ways to set goals for the New Year. We talk about the importance of setting specific and measurable goals, as well as how to use your own brain chemistry to help you achieve your new habits.

A science-based, humor laced approach to health and fitness. With the help of top researchers from the health and wellness fields, Juna Gjata and Dr. Eddie Phillips break down the science behind good nutrition, exercise, stress, sleep, and more. Includes a generous helping of sarcasm (Juna), dad jokes (Eddie), and pristine sound design (our awesome producers).
